Second, if you were to import an engine that is not sold locally, you will have to expect to import at least some of the spare parts for it (the ones that are not the same as the locally sold engine). Working out any warranty issues from long distance might also be rather slow.
Sometimes when there are frequent model changes, a low volume distributor (such as B&S here in Australia) may decide not to handle all of the models, but to wait for major changes each time. Otherwise they would constantly be liquidating old stock at a discount, and stocking spare parts would be a nightmare. I am not saying that is what has happened here, but it is a possibility you might be able to clarify with a phone call to B&S.
